DetoxificationDetoxification is often the first step in the treatment process at rehab centers for PTSD treatment in Mason. This crucial service involves medically supervised withdrawal from substances that may be exacerbating anxiety and trauma symptoms. Detox not only helps to clear the body of harmful substances but also ensures that individuals are stabilized before engaging in therapy. During detox, patients receive round-the-clock care from medical professionals who monitor their health and provide necessary interventions for any withdrawal symptoms. The goal is to create a safe and supportive environment that allows patients to focus on their recovery from both PTSD and any co-occurring substance use disorders.
Inpatient TreatmentInpatient treatment programs provide an intensive level of care for individuals struggling with PTSD. Here, patients live at the facility and have access to a comprehensive range of therapeutic services throughout the day. This type of immersion allows for a deep focus on healing, with structured schedules that include individual therapy, group sessions, and various activities designed for emotional support and skill-building. In a healing environment away from daily stressors, individuals can develop coping mechanisms, recognize triggers, and build strong foundations for long-term recovery. Inpatient treatment is particularly beneficial for those with co-occurring mental health issues or severe symptoms that require more support and monitoring.
Outpatient TreatmentOutpatient treatment is a flexible option offered by many PTSD treatment rehab centers in Mason, allowing individuals to attend therapy sessions without having to reside at the facility. This service is ideal for those who require support but have responsibilities at home or work. Outpatient programs typically involve weekly therapy sessions, group counseling, and educational workshops. Patients learn to apply the coping strategies they acquire in real-life situations, which reinforces their healing process. Additionally, outpatient treatment encourages continued engagement with support networks at home and helps bridge the gap between intensive treatment and independent living.
Counseling and TherapyCounseling and therapy are at the heart of treatment for PTSD. At rehab centers for PTSD treatment in Mason, various therapeutic modalities are employed, including c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T), eye movement desensitization, and reprocessing (EMDR), and dialectical behavior therapy (DBT). Each approach targets the symptoms and root causes of PTSD, enabling patients to explore traumatic memories in a safe environment while developing effective coping strategies. Individual therapy allows for tailored sessions addressing specific issues, while group therapy promotes sharing experiences and learning from others. This blend of counseling approaches fosters a comprehensive understanding of the disorder and paves the way for healing.
12-Step and Non-12-Step ProgramsMany rehab centers in Mason offer both 12-step and non-12-step recovery programs, catering to the diverse beliefs and needs of their clients. The 12-step model, which emphasizes spiritual growth and community support, has been widely adopted for addiction treatment. However, non-12-step programs focus on evidence-based practices and personal empowerment instead, allowing individuals to choose paths that resonate with their values. This inclusion of varied methodologies ensures that every patient receives a personalized treatment plan, enhancing their chances of sustained recovery. Programs are often comprehensive, combining these approaches with therapy and counseling to address underlying PTSD issues.
Aftercare ServicesAftercare services are essential for patients exiting treatment programs, ensuring that they maintain their progress and continue to receive support. This phase often includes ongoing counseling, support groups, and access to resources for employment, housing, and further education. Aftercare helps bridge the critical transition from rehab to everyday life, reinforcing coping strategies learned during initial treatment. Many facilities in Mason provide a structured plan for aftercare, which may involve regular check-ins, workshops, and community events that keep individuals engaged. This long-term support is vital for sustaining recovery and minimizing the risk of relapse into PTSD symptoms or substance use.

Insurance CoverageMany rehab centers for PTSD treatment in Mason accept various insurance plans, which can significantly reduce the financial burden of treatment. Insurance coverage often includes assessments, therapy sessions, medications, and facility stay fees. Patients are encouraged to check with their providers to understand the specifics of their plans and what services are covered. This option enables individuals to access high-quality care while mitigating out-of-pocket expenses. Understanding insurance policies can empower patients to seek the treatment they need without worrying overly about costs.
Payment PlansFlexible payment plans offered by rehab centers allow patients to break down the cost of treatment into more manageable monthly payments. This approach aims to make treatment accessible to those who may not have immediate funds or adequate insurance coverage. These plans can cover treatments ranging from outpatient sessions to longer inpatient stays, and facilities typically work closely with clients to set feasible payment terms. This facility flexibility underscores the commitment of rehab centers to make recovery accessible for everyone, regardless of financial background.
Government GrantsGovernment grants are available to assist individuals seeking treatment for PTSD. These grants can help cover costs for those who may be uninsured or underinsured, focusing on lower-income individuals and veterans. Several programs are designed specifically to facilitate access to mental health resources, often working directly with rehab centers to ensure funds are used effectively. Individuals interested in leveraging these grants are encouraged to reach out to local organizations and government agencies for assistance, helping ease the financial pressure during recovery.
Sliding Scale FeesSome rehab centers for PTSD treatment in Mason provide sliding scale fees based on the individual's income level. This pricing model adjusts the treatment costs according to what the patient can afford to pay. It serves to make quality care more available to a broader demographic, removing financial barriers that may prevent individuals from seeking help. Many facilities assess financial circumstances upfront to offer a transparent and compassionate approach to billing, fostering a sense of inclusivity in the recovery community.
Financial Assistance ProgramsVarious financial assistance programs are available to support individuals pursuing treatment for PTSD. Many rehab centers collaborate with non-profit organizations and local agencies to provide scholarships or need-based support to cover the cost of services. Eligible individuals can often access additional resources that may alleviate some of the financial burdens associated with treatment costs. This service reflects the centers' dedication to ensuring that financial constraints do not hinder the pursuit of recovery.
Crowdfunding and Fundraising OptionsIn addition to traditional financing methods, some individuals turn to crowdfunding or fundraising platforms to assist with treatment costs. These options involve sharing personal stories and outlining treatment needs to garner support from friends, family, and the wider community. Many rehab centers encourage this approach as it can relieve financial pressures, enabling patients to focus entirely on their recovery. Creating a campaign allows individuals to take charge of their financial health while simultaneously raising awareness about the importance of trauma-informed care.
